Episode: #9: Papua New Guinea, the most linguistically diverse place in the world and the ill fate of Michael Rockefeller
Description: In this episode we are transitioning to the region of Oceania. Papua New Guinea is the second most populous in Oceania with about 10 Million people, and it is probably the most linguistically diverse and culturally diverse place in the world with more than 850 languages spoken by 1,000 distinct cultures and tribes. We also learn about the ill fate of Michael Rockefeller, the great grandson of John D. Rockefeller, Sr, who died in PNG in 1961.
